WA Gold drills into prolific WA Bullabulling gold shear zone
WA Gold Limited began aircore drilling at its Bullabulling project, 30 kilometers west of Coolgardie, on Monday. The program will include 46 holes over 3,680 meters to target gold mineralization in a prolific shear zone. The initiative tests previously unexamined areas, aiming to confirm the extension of valuable gold resources into WA Gold's tenure.
